How This Service Actually Works
Tile floors can hide water for days, leading to mold, cracks, and structural issues. A rushed job? That’s a recipe for bigger problems. Our process is built on speed, precision, and attention to detail. You don’t want to wait for a fix that doesn’t last.
Assessment and Inspection
Your team starts by checking the extent of the damage. They use moisture meters and thermal imaging to find hidden water. This step is key. It tells you exactly what you’re up against and how to fix it. No guesswork. Just clear answers.
Water Extraction
They remove standing water in under 60 minutes. High-powered extractors get the job done fast. The quicker they act, the less damage they deal with. You don’t want to let water sit. It’s a ticking time bomb.
Drying and Dehumidification
Specialized air movers and dehumidifiers take over. These tools work around the clock. It’s not just about drying. It’s about stopping mold before it starts. You need this step done right. Otherwise, the damage could come back.
Surface Cleaning and Sanitization
Once the area is dry, they clean and sanitize your tile. This step is critical for health and safety. You don’t want mold or bacteria lingering. It’s a final check to make sure your space is safe to use again.
Final Inspection and Documentation
Your team does a final check to make sure everything is back to normal. They document the work for your insurance. This is where you get the proof you need. It helps your claim move faster and gives you peace of mind.

Warning Signs You Need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ration
Ignoring early warning signs can lead to expensive repairs. You need to act fast. The sooner you get help, the less damage you’ll face. It’s not a small job. It’s a big deal.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A damp smell in your home is a red flag. It means water is hiding in your tiles or under the floor. You need to act. That smell won’t go away on its own. It’s a sign of mold and bacteria.
Warping or Bubbling Tiles
If your tiles are lifting or looking warped, water is the cause. This is serious. It means the floor is damaged. You don’t want to walk on it. It could break or cause injury.
Cracks or Discoloration
Water can cause cracks or color changes in your tile. This isn’t normal. It’s a sign of deep damage. You need to get help before it gets worse. It’s not just an aesthetic issue. It’s structural.
Swelling or Soft Spots on the Floor
If your floor feels soft or swells in certain areas, that’s a problem. Water is getting under the surface. You need to fix it fast. It could lead to more damage and higher costs.
Visible Mold Growth
Mold is a health hazard. You see it on your tiles or around the edges? That’s bad. It means water is trapped and growing. You need to call a pro. Mold doesn’t go away on its own. It spreads quickly.
Increased Humidity in the Room
Higher humidity levels in a specific area mean water is trapped. It’s not just uncomfortable. It’s dangerous. You need to find the source and fix it. It’s a sign of hidden damage you can’t ignore.
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small puddle on a clean tile floor | Yes | No | It’s manageable. Just dry it fast. |
| Water under the floor for more than 24 hours | No | Yes | It’s too late for a quick fix. Mold is likely. |
| Tile is lifting or warping | No | Yes | It’s structural. You need experts. |
| Visible mold growth on or near the floor | No | Yes | Mold is dangerous. You need to get rid of it safely. |
| Water damage in a high-traffic area | No | Yes | It’s a safety risk. You need to restore it quickly. |
| Water from a sewage backup | No | Yes | It’s a health hazard. You need professionals. |

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ost In Durham, NC
Costs vary based on the size of the area, how long the water was there, and the type of damage. These are estimates. They help you plan, but they’re not guarantees. You need to get a clear picture of what’s involved.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ial inspection and assessment | $100 – $300 | Time of day and complexity of the job. |
| Water extraction | $200 – $700 | Amount of water and location of the damage.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$500 – $1,500 | Size of the area and humidity levels. |
| Surface cleaning and sanitization | $300 – $800 | Type of tile and extent of contamination. |
| Final inspection and documentation | $150 – $400 | Amount of work and insurance requirements. |
| Repair or replacement of damaged tiles | $50 – $200 per tile | Material quality and labor costs. |

Common Questions About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ration
How Much Does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ost?
Costs vary based on the size, depth, and timing of the damage. You can exp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for a full restoration. It’s important to get an on-site assessment. Our team helps you understand the costs and how to file a claim.
How Long Does the Restoration Process Take?
It usually takes 3-5 days. The time depends on how much water was there and how quickly we start. You don’t want to wait. The faster you act, the less damage you face. Our team moves fast and keeps you informed every step of the way.
Is There a Health Risk From Water Damage on Tile Floors?
Yes, mold and bacteria can grow in hidden water. That’s a health risk. You need to make sure the area is fully dry and cleaned. Our team uses safe, professional methods to remove all contaminants. You don’t want to risk your family’s health.
What Equipment Is Used for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ration?
We use high-powered extractors, air movers, and dehumidifiers. These tools remove water and dry the area quickly. It’s not just about cleaning. It’s about stopping damage before it starts. Our equipment is designed for tile floors and works fast.
How Can I Prevent Tile Floor Water Damage?
Fix leaks quickly and keep drains clear. You should also check for cracks or gaps in your tiles. Water can get in through small openings. It’s a good idea to have your floors inspected regularly. Our team can help you spot early signs of damage before it becomes a problem.
